Sql dba basic concepts pdf

May 05, 2015 introduction to basic database concepts. If you want a dbms, you the sql server database engine is a really good choice. You could write books on sql server reference and study material. Our sql tutorial is designed for beginners and professionals. This tutorial explains some basic and advanced concepts of sql server such as how to create and restore data, create login and backup, assign permissions. Dbms allows the definition, creation, querying, update, and administration of databases. Azure sql database is a relational databaseasaservice dbaas based on the latest stable version of microsoft sql server. If you continue browsing the site, you agree to the use of cookies on this website. Ks, in rom basic, the version of basic that was built into the first ibm. It covers most of the topics required for a basic understanding of sql and to get a feel of how it works. With a linked server, you can create very clean, easy to follow, sql statements that allow remote data to be retrieved, joined and combined with local data. Sql tutorial sql is a database computer language designed for the retrieval and management of data in relational database.

Teach yourself sql in 21 days, second edition acknowledgments a special thanks to the following individuals. Rdbms is the basis for sql, and for all modern database systems like ms sql server, ibm db2, oracle, mysql, and microsoft access. System databases are databases that are created when sql server is installed. Sql is a standard language for accessing and manipulating databases. Linked servers is a concept in sql server by which we can add other sql server to a group and query both the sql server dbs using t sql statements. Here is the list of most frequently asked sql server dba interview questions and answers in technical interviews. I structured query language i usually talk to a database server i used as front end to many databases mysql, postgresql, oracle, sybase i three subsystems. Conceptually, you can think of an oracle database as nothing more than a large electronic filing cabinet, a place to store and retrieve information. Database is a structured set of data stored electronically. The idea was to define a common method of storing data that would allow you to retrieve specific information without detailed knowledge of the underlying database engine.

Relational database management system rdbms brief history of oracle database. Please follow the links below, try devoting an hour at least. Oracle dba tutorial guide for beginners janbasktraining. One reason that oracle has become the world dominant database is because it. This tutorial will give you enough understanding on the various components of sql along with suitable examples. A database that contains two or more related tables is called a relational database. Rdbms stands for r elational d atabase m anagement s ystem. Mar 15, 20 verify that sql server is sending database mail properly. Since many versions of sql server is out in market but core remains same. Here, we have given oracle dba tutorials for the beginners to help you in getting started with a career in the database world.

Sql is structured query language, which is a computer language for storing, manipulating and retrieving data stored in a relational database. Bol still and always one of the best places to find out things about sql server. Perform system maintenance, such as disk defragmentation, windows updates, sql server cumulative updates. A simple guide to mysql basic database administration commands.

These databases are used for various operational and management activities for sql server. Sql became a standard of the american national standards institute ansi in 1986, and of the international organization for standardization iso in 1987. Here also, some of the lessons are for sql server 2012 only. A msdb database stores information related to backups, sql server agent information, sql server jobs, alerts and so on. Language supported and widely used for querying and accessing the database is sql. Jun 03, 2010 microsoft sql server has a lot of components that you can use. Sql dba training course overview sql server installation and. The tutorial includes oracle dba basics that have been compiled after reading multiple books and reference links.

B 2 weeks module 4 azure sql database fundamentals and azure tuning plan b 1 week. Also, thank you jordan for your encouragement over the past few years. The tutorial can help you handle various aspects of the sql programming language. These are top sql server dba interview questions and answers, prepared by our institute experienced trainers.

Audience this reference has been prepared for the beginners to help them understand the basic to advanced concepts related to sql languages. Fulltext search, and tools for managing relational and xml data. Each time we discuss a new concept, youll put it into code and see what you can do with it. Relational databases and sql were developed in the early 1970s at ibm. Microsoft sql server is relational database software, so lets explore some relational database concepts. Mar 24, 2020 each sql command comes with clear and concise examples. Sql server dba interview questions and answers for the job placements. In this oracle dba tutorial, next, we have collated the basic terms used in oracle rdbms.

Along with these, quizzes help validate your basic knowledge of the language. After a lot of thinking, i honed in on the concept of an exceptional dba. Introduction to database administration oreilly media. Part 5 basics of database administration in sql server.

Ms sql server dba training course dba university inc. A database that contains only one table is called a flat database. The documentation change with almost every release, but the basic topics remain the same. Audience this tutorial is prepared for beginners to help them understand the basic as well as the advanced concepts related to sql languages. Sql concepts are nothing but those core things that one must know. Sql structured query language is used to perform operations on the records stored in the database such as updating records, deleting records, creating and modifying tables, views, etc. In the next chapter, you build on the basic concepts of this chapter and. The dba works at the intersection of the database, server, operations group, and developers. A dba must understand concepts from all these facets of it as well as be able to draw upon knowledge of their production environment to troubleshoot performance, hardware, and software issues.

It is defined as the background process and memory structure used to retrieve data from a database. A relational database management system rdbms is a database management system dbms that is based on the relational model as introduced by e. Building a database environment starts by designing the application architecture, setting up the ict infra. The rows in a table are called records and the columns in a table are called fields or attributes. All the relational database management systems rdms like mysql, ms access, oracle, sybase, informix, postgres. In addition to the list of sql commands, the tutorial presents flashcards with sql functions, such as avg, count, and max. There is documentation about oracle concepts, database administration, backup and recovery and there is also reference documentation that contains details on parameters and sql command syntax. Pdf sql server dba training material redbush technologies. Mysql basic database administration commands part i. Feb 24, 2015 microsoft sql server is relational database software, so lets explore some relational database concepts.

Database modeling and design electrical engineering and. In this article, we will learn the basics of sql server database administration. Although sql is an ansiiso standard, there are different versions of the sql language. Audience this reference has been prepared for the beginners to help them understand the basic to advanced. Learn four system databases in sql server, master, msdb, tempdb and model. The database consists of data which can be a numeric, alphabetic and also alphanumeric form. At the computer level, oracle is a computer program that manages an electronic filing cabinet.

Future versions of this tutorial will be available at. Msdbdata and msdblog are the logical file names of a msdb database. Verify that data access speed is running at normal levels. Sql is the standard language for relational database system. Azure sql database is a generalpurpose relational database, provided as a managed service. R version, packages and datasets we already learned in the last lesson how we can check the version of r server with which the database engine is communicating. Jul 14, 2017 in this lesson, we will be learning the basic concepts of r, just sufficient enough for us to apply r functions and packages against a sql server data repository. Part 6 have a great day ahead, and keep sharing your knowledge. May 14, 2020 to learn oracle dba, it is required to understand the basic terminology used in it. Sql server dba concepts core dba concepts of sql server the history of sql server and relational databases relational database history and sql server and ansi standards relation between application and database overview of windows concepts role of windows operating system in sql server administration windows operating system basics overview of builtin accounts, service. Sql server dba interview questions and answers 2020 updated. Transact sql is closely integrated into the sql language, yet it adds programming constructs that are not native to sql.

Basic r concepts sql server tips, techniques and articles. The concept of database was known to our ancestors even when there were no computers, however creating and maintaining such database was very tedious job. Analyzing data is a key feature of database management system that is dbms. With it, you can create a highly available and highperformance data storage layer for the applications and solutions in azure. We expect that the participant of the lab is familiar with sql basics and knows how to use sql commands with the tools of the selected dbms contents introduction 2 part i concepts 4 database administrator roles 4 database. Introduction to database concepts sl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. Mysql, postgresql, oracle, and sql server are all relational databases. Sql tutorial provides basic and advanced concepts of sql. It is important that you understand the basic ideas behind sql server indexes.

Compare sql server run book specifications against current configuration. Microsoft sql server 2016 architecture understanding sql server system databases and business nonsystem databases. Sql server concepts and best practices to build transact sql. Relational database concepts sql server tutoria mssql t. Relational database concepts a relational database includes one or more tables, which. If you want to start your career as an oracle dba then you have reached the right place. Appendix 1 first steps in sql server administration. There is more to being a junior dba than knowing sql. Sql some relational database concepts i a database server can contain many databases i databases are collections of tables i tables are twodimensional with rows observations and columns variables i limited mathematical and summary operations available i very good at combining information from several tables. Routine sql server dba tasks house of brick technologies.

959 498 691 1093 931 500 247 1024 1038 88 154 91 1413 135 580 1019 447 240 1271 182 978 1077 1458 592 1298 1492 649 1445 17 1013 923 93 320 377 1304 949 837